Bob Esponja is the Latin Spanish and Castillian Spanish dub of SpongeBob SquarePants. It is shown on Nickelodeon Spain and Latin America, Canal 5, other Spanish-speaking countries, and on Nickelodeon's On-Demand service.

Changed Names

Most of the names have been changed, although Gary's is the same.

Trivia

  • Calamardo (Squidward's Spanish name) is based off from "calamari".
  • Whenever there is text on the screen, a voice-over reads it in Spanish. This is because the text is always in English, due to the fact that the show is originally American, and the producers didn't want to bother re-animating the scenes with the text to make it in Spanish.
